Before gastric bypass, food (see arrows) enters your stomach and passes into the small intestine. After surgery, the amount of food you can eat is reduced due to the smaller stomach pouch. Food is also redirected so that it bypasses most of your stomach and the first section of your small intestine (duodenum). refoulassiez https://myaboriginal.com

If you are way behind on water, do not … WebAfter gastric bypass or other bariatric surgery, a condition called dumping syndrome will occur if you eat foods high in sugar and fat (greater than 10 grams per serving). Symptoms of dumping syndrome include profound sleepiness, light-headedness, profuse sweating, rapid heart rate, cramping abdominal pain, nausea and diarrhea. refoss wireless doorbell

WebDoctors recommend that post-bariatric surgery patients take bariatric supplements to ensure proper nutrition following their procedure. These supplements may include: Complete multivitamins. Vitamin B12. Calcium with Vitamin D. Iron and Vitamin C. Vitamin D. These vitamins help you to meet your nutritional needs when you are consuming less food. WebOct 26, 2024 · Soft fish, such as tilapia, cod, and haddock. Softened vegetables, like carrots, green beans, and squash. Scrambled eggs. Mashed potatoes and mashed sweet potatoes. Low-fat small curd cottage cheese. Light yogurt or light Greek yogurt. Vegetable soups with finely chopped meats and vegetables. Canned chicken or tuna.
